Install kustomize in release workflow
This commit is contained in:
		
							parent
							
								
									c33cc6b245
								
							
						
					
					
						commit
						80ebb57a81
					
				|  | @ -11,6 +11,7 @@ jobs: | ||||||
|       uses: actions/checkout@v2 |       uses: actions/checkout@v2 | ||||||
|     - name: Install tools |     - name: Install tools | ||||||
|       run: | |       run: | | ||||||
|  |         curl -s https://raw.githubusercontent.com/kubernetes-sigs/kustomize/master/hack/install_kustomize.sh | bash | ||||||
|         curl -L -O https://github.com/kubernetes-sigs/kubebuilder/releases/download/v2.2.0/kubebuilder_2.2.0_linux_amd64.tar.gz |         curl -L -O https://github.com/kubernetes-sigs/kubebuilder/releases/download/v2.2.0/kubebuilder_2.2.0_linux_amd64.tar.gz | ||||||
|         tar zxvf kubebuilder_2.2.0_linux_amd64.tar.gz |         tar zxvf kubebuilder_2.2.0_linux_amd64.tar.gz | ||||||
|         sudo mv kubebuilder_2.2.0_linux_amd64 /usr/local/kubebuilder |         sudo mv kubebuilder_2.2.0_linux_amd64 /usr/local/kubebuilder | ||||||
|  |  | ||||||
							
								
								
									
										2
									
								
								Makefile
								
								
								
								
							
							
						
						
									
										2
									
								
								Makefile
								
								
								
								
							|  | @ -63,7 +63,7 @@ docker-push: | ||||||
| 	docker push ${NAME}:${VERSION} | 	docker push ${NAME}:${VERSION} | ||||||
| 
 | 
 | ||||||
| # Generate the release manifest file
 | # Generate the release manifest file
 | ||||||
| release: | release: test | ||||||
| 	mkdir -p release | 	mkdir -p release | ||||||
| 	kustomize build config/default > release/actions-runner-controller.yaml | 	kustomize build config/default > release/actions-runner-controller.yaml | ||||||
| 
 | 
 | ||||||
|  |  | ||||||
		Loading…
	
		Reference in New Issue